Understanding the Role of Excavating Contractors

Excavating contractors are professionals who specialize in earthmoving operations such as digging, grading, and site preparation. They play a critical role in laying the groundwork for various construction projects – from residential homes to large commercial developments. Their expertise ensures that sites are properly prepared for subsequent stages of construction, making their role indispensable.

Why Licensing Matters

Hiring licensed excavating contractors is essential for several reasons. Firstly, licensing ensures that the contractor has met specific education and training requirements set by local regulations. This not only assures you that they possess adequate knowledge but also that they understand safety protocols and best practices necessary to avoid accidents during excavation processes.

Compliance with Local Regulations

Licensed contractors are usually well-versed in local building codes and regulations related to excavation work. This means they can navigate permits effectively and ensure compliance with laws governing land use, environmental protection, and safety standards. By hiring a licensed professional, you mitigate risks associated with fines or rework due to non-compliance.

Quality Assurance Through Experience

Experienced licensed excavating contractors bring a wealth of knowledge to your project. They understand soil types, drainage issues, and other geological factors that may affect excavation outcomes. Their experience allows them to anticipate potential challenges ahead of time and implement solutions quickly—ensuring smooth progress from start to finish.
